Key Metrics in Casino Evaluation
| Criterion | Description |
|---|---|
| Licensing & Regulation | Ensures the platform operates under legal oversight, safeguarding player funds and enforcing fairness. |
| Game Fairness & Randomness | Verified through independent audits, guaranteeing that game outcomes are unbiased and unpredictable. |
| Security Measures | Includes SSL encryption, secure payment gateways, and robust privacy policies that protect sensitive data. |
| Payout Speed & History | Evaluates how swiftly and consistently winnings are paid, along with user-reported payout experiences. |
| Customer Support Quality | Assesses responsiveness, professionalism, and accessibility of support channels. |
